  1. It is with great sadness I let you all know that my grandfather, the Reverend Kenneth Newbon, passed away in November aged 86. He had been battling some health issues for over a year and after a brief illness of pneumonia he passed into 'God's Great Kingdom'. He was well known for his railway, 'West Midland' the title granted to him by the late Edward Beal who grandpa became friends with through the railway modeller. His layout was gifted to the late Victor Harman of Sleaford who kept it running until his untimely death from Parkinsons. Now the mantle has passed to me to carry on the family tradition of model railways. Ben, 'The Antipodean Grandson'
  2. Hello all, I thought i would make this my first post instead of my original intention which was to post my grandfather's obituary. I am currently residing in Australia where I am in the process of making a new layout that will allow me to run both oo9 and oo stock. I built a oo9 layout a few years back and was happy with the result but wanted to completely over haul the way i had it wired and in the end, starting from scratch using the information I had learned along the way, was by far the easiest course of action. My plan is to recreate the Hereford-Hay station of Eardisley with a twist. Instead of the branchline that went to Titley Junction, I would have a narrow gauge railway instead. Now I am in the process of design, research and planning. I look forward to keeping you all in the loop Ben
